Population growth and global health disparities for many reproductive and perinatal outcomes are but a few of the pressing issues facing public health today. Despite growing interest in the field, formal training in reproductive and perinatal epidemiology remains limited, with few available textbooks aimed at providing an overview of the field. In response to this need, faculty from the Eunice Kennedy Shriver National Institute of Child Health & Human Development (NICHD) and CIHR's Institute of Human Development, Child and Youth Health (IHDCYH) developed an intensive, competitive, Summer Institute in Reproductive and Perinatal Epidemiology. The curriculum of this Summer Institute has been developed into a textbook to provide students and researchers with a working knowledge of the substantive and methodologic issues underlying reproductive and perinatal epidemiology. Reproductive and Perinatal Epidemiology offers a core curriculum that addresses the epidemiology of major reproductive and perinatal outcomes. From human fecundity to birth and neonatal outcomes, the subject is approached from as international a perspective as possible, and the unique methodologic issues underlying each outcome are discussed. Analytic procedures suitable for the study of human disease are scattered throughout the statistical and epidemiologic literature. Explanations of their properties are frequently presented in mathematical and theoretical language. This well-established text gives readers a clear understanding of the statistical methods that are widely used in epidemiologic research without depending on advanced mathematical or statistical theory. By applying these methods to actual data, Selvin reveals the strengths and weaknesses of each analytic approach. He combines techniques from the fields of statistics, biostatistics, demography and epidemiology to present a comprehensive overview that does not require computational details of the statistical techniques described. For the Third Edition, Selvin took out some old material (e.g. the section on rarely used cross-over designs) and added new material (e.g. sections on frequently used contingency table analysis). Throughout the text he enriched existing discussions with new elements, including the analysis of multi-level categorical data and simple, intuitive arguments that exponential survival times cause the hazard function to be constant. He added a dozen new applied examples to illustrate such topics as the pitfalls of proportional mortality data, the analysis of matched pair categorical data, and the age-adjustment of mortality rates based on statistical models. The most important new feature is a chapter on Poisson regression analysis. This essential statistical tool permits the multivariable analysis of rates, probabilities and counts.
